Haryana Chief Minister Nayab Singh Saini attended the 'Dhanak Samaj Sammelan' in Ludhiana, Punjab, on Sunday, 28 June 2026, marking the 628th Prakat Diwas (manifestation anniversary) of Sant Shiromani Kabir Ji Maharaj. The CM paid his reverential tribute to the 15th-century saint-poet at the gathering organised by the Dhanak community.

Saini, posting in Hindi on X, wrote: 'Aaj Punjab ke Ludhiana mein Sant Shiromani Kabir Ji Maharaj ke 628ve Prakat Diwas par aayojit Dhanak Samaj Sammelan mein shamil hokar unhe shraddhapoovak naman kiya' — 'Today, I attended the Dhanak Samaj Sammelan organised in Ludhiana, Punjab, on the occasion of the 628th Prakat Diwas of Sant Shiromani Kabir Ji Maharaj, and paid my reverential tribute to him.' He added that Kabir Ji's messages of truth, social harmony, equality, and humanity continue to provide a new direction to society even today.

Policy Backdrop

Sant Kabir (c. 1398–1518) is venerated across northern India as a reformer who challenged caste discrimination and religious orthodoxy through his dohas (couplets), drawing followers from both Hindu and Muslim traditions. The Dhanak community — a scheduled caste group with significant presence in Haryana and Punjab — regards Kabir Ji as a spiritual and social patron. Kabir Jayanti, observed on the full moon of the Hindu month of Jyeshtha, is a significant occasion for Dalit and OBC communities across the Hindi belt, and political leaders across the spectrum routinely attend such gatherings to reaffirm their outreach to these constituencies.

Stakeholders and Impact

The Dhanak community constitutes a notable portion of the electorate in several constituencies spanning Haryana and border districts of Punjab. CM Saini's presence at the Ludhiana event — held outside his home state — signals the BJP's continued focus on consolidating support among scheduled caste communities in the broader region. Sant Kabir's philosophy of samrasta (social harmony) and samanta (equality) is frequently invoked by political leaders to frame welfare and social-justice messaging, lending the occasion both cultural and political weight.
